10% Drop ACA Coverage as Subsidies Expire, Costs Surge

3/23/2026

26 4 Full Breakdown

1 of 1

Story summary
  • A Kaiser Family Foundation (KFF) survey shows 10% of Americans in Affordable Care Act (ACA) plans dropped insurance after subsidies expired in 2026.
  • The average premium reached $1,904 in 2026, more than double last year's.
  • Among those who retained coverage, 80% report higher costs, fearing they cannot afford care.
  • The expiration of enhanced subsidies sparked political division, with Democrats blaming Republicans for rising costs.
